Francis Parkes, known as Frank, was a Harland and Wolff employee. He oversaw Titanic's maiden voyage. He died in the sinking. He was born in Belfast, Co Down, Ireland on November 8th, 1890. He was the son of James Parkes (b. 1851) and his wife Elizabeth, née Jervis (b. 1852). His father, a native of Co Tyrone, worked as a school attendance officer and was married to his wife Elizabeth, a Co Down native, in 1885. The couple had six other children besides Francis: Matthew James (b. 1887), Robert George (b. 1889), Charles (b. 1893), William Frederick (b. 1895), Elizabeth Mary (b. 1898) and Violet Maud (b. 1901). He grew up in an Church of Ireland household.
